Major Gonzales County Real Estate Markets

The city of Gonzales serves as the county seat and primary real estate hub, offering historic homes, new construction, and commercial opportunities along its charming downtown corridor. Nixon, the county's second-largest community, attracts buyers with its proximity to San Antonio and more affordable land prices. Smaller communities like Smiley, Cost, and Waelder provide rural residential options and recreational properties that appeal to those seeking larger acreage and country living.

Each market area serves distinct buyer demographics, from first-time homebuyers drawn to Gonzales' walkable downtown to investors seeking development opportunities in Nixon's growth corridor. The county's location along major transportation routes, including Highway 183 and Highway 90A, enhances accessibility and supports property values across these diverse market segments.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Gonzales County's real estate market operates on relationship-driven transactions, where local knowledge and personal connections often determine deal success. Properties range from historic Victorian homes in downtown Gonzales to sprawling ranches and hunting properties scattered throughout the county's 1,070 square miles. The market sees significant seasonal variation, with ranch and recreational properties experiencing peak activity during hunting seasons and spring months.

Geographic challenges include varying property access, diverse zoning regulations across municipalities, and significant price differences between improved and raw land. Agricultural exemptions, water rights, and mineral rights frequently complicate transactions, requiring agents with specialized local expertise. These factors create a market where generic approaches often fail, making local professional relationships essential for successful transactions.
